One of the available marriage candidates in Stardew Valley is Sam, and he’s a pretty cool guy. Whether you’re looking to marry him or just become friends, you’ll want to give him his favorite gifts. Wondering what they are? Look no further.

Loved Gifts

stardew valley pizza

Finding some gifts that Sam will love is actually pretty easy. He has four things for which you’ll receive 80 friendship points, outside of the universal loves (covered below). These include Cactus Fruit, Maple Bars, Pizza, and Tigerseye. You’ll receive 8x the friendship points for giving Sam a gift on his birthday, which is Summer 17.

Two of Sam’s gifts are cooked dishes, one of which you’ll have to make — Maple Bars. These are made from maple syrup, sugar, and wheat flour. He also loves Pizza, which you can make from cheese, tomato, and wheat flour, but is in the Saloon’s stock every day.

Tigerseye is a gem that can be found inside Magma Geodes and Omni Geodes. Finally, Cactus Fruit can mainly be grown from Cactus Seeds, found while foraging in the Calico Desert, bought from the Oasis shop.

Liked Gifts

Sam only has a few gifts that he likes, netting you 45 friendship points, outside of the universal likes list. He likes Joja Cola, which is found in abundance while fishing, in trash cans, or from the vending machine (also from JojaMart if it’s still open in your game).

Sam also likes eggs, save for Void Eggs, which he dislikes. Note that Dinosaur Eggs are artifacts, not eggs.

Universal Gifts in Stardew Valley

There is a short list of universally-loved gifts in Stardew Valley, and Sam is no exception to any of the items on it. It includes Prismatic Shards, rabbit’s feet, Magic Rock Candy, the Golden Pumpkin, and pearls.

There are also some universal likes. These include maple syrup, Life Elixir, and most items from the following categories: artisan goods, cooked dishes, flowers, foraged minerals, gems, vegetables, and fruit tree fruits. Sam isn’t an exception to most of these items, but he does dislike most vegetables and he hates duck mayonnaise, regular mayonnaise, and pickles.
